The packaging box packing machine (hereinafter abbreviated as an packing machine) is generally a device that can be seen in an automation machine, and each device necessary for the assembly process of the box is installed around a conveyor on which an object to be worked is placed and transported .
A plurality of guiding devices are required on the conveyor for moving the box in such an adhesive machine to prevent the paper to be worked from being lifted to the upper surface of the conveyor.
In the conventional configuration of the guide device, a guider having a long rod shape for pressing the upper surface of the paper and a support for mounting the guider at a predetermined position of the gluing device on one side excluding the upper surface of the guider.
Further, when the guider is formed too long, it is difficult to store and assemble it, so that it is manufactured to have an appropriate length and a plurality of guiders are mounted according to the guided section.
Since the conventional guide device as described above is required to be mounted several times on one side of the conveyor as described above, it is cumbersome to mount the guide device on the adhesive machine, and since the support band is formed in each guider, .
However, when the size of the paper is small, the end portion of the paper flows down between the gap between the guider and the guider, so that the end surface of the guider The raw paper leaves the conveyor on the conveyor and the product is often defective.
The present invention provides a guide device mounted on a predetermined position of a bonding machine so that an upper surface of a paper can be pushed in order to prevent a paper from being lifted upward when the paper is moved on a conveyor on a conveyor of a packing box- A guider body mounted at a predetermined position of the packaging box adhesive machine and formed in the shape of a tube; An extension guider that is slidably coupled to the inside of the guider body to change a length of a section where the paper is guided and has an end bent at a predetermined angle to the upper side; And a fixing member penetrating from an outer end surface to an inner circumferential surface of the guider body to be screwed with the guider body to fix the guider after the guider is moved from the body.
The present invention further includes a step cover formed by extending a predetermined length from the bottom surface of the extension guider to the guider body side to prevent the step formed when the extension guider is fitted in the guider body from interfering with the progress of the original paper do.
As described above, according to the present invention, the length of the guider can be changed corresponding to the size of the paper moved on the conveyor, and the inclination of the end portion of the guider can be made upward so that when the work is performed, It is possible to solve the problem of defective position due to the collision, and the number of mounting of the guider in the guide section can be reduced by the variable guider so that the mounting operation of the guider can be performed more quickly And the manufacturing cost of the bonding machine can be reduced at the same time.
